CPSC, Bradshaw International Inc. Announce Recall of Bottle Sipper Caps

Reported: September 15, 2005 Initiated: September 15, 2005 #05270

Product Description

The recalled bottle sippers have white screw-on bases with dark blue, green or red pull-up valves. They are sold in packages of three. The package is labeled "Bottle Sippers." Bradshaw International Inc. and #70118 are written on the back of the package.

Reason for Recall

The pull-up valve can detach from the cap, posing a choking hazard to young children.

Remedy

Consumers should stop using these recalled bottle sippers immediately and return them to the store where purchased for a refund.
